Russian Reporter

Background

Russian Reporter is a reporter for Soviet Central News in Russia.

During the events of Independence Day (1996) played by Peter J. Lucas

George Putnam gives a report on events taking place in Russia, which is then explained locally by Russian Reporter who describes the hysteria in the area as a large object appears out of the sky.
